GPs in Auckland are being assured their confidence in Labtests will be restored as quickly as possible. At a meeting tonight around 70 doctors voiced their concerns about the city's new laboratory testing provider. GPs passed an overwhelming vote of no confidence in Labtests after outlining problems with sample tracking and concerns over the competence of Labtests' staff. DHB Chairman Pat Snedden told the group he hears their concerns and the boards have taken unprecedented action to fix the problems. He says restoring confidence in the service is his number one priority.
